Know About the Usage and Utility of a Corner Rack

Whether you are the owner of a grocery store or a bookstore, as a business owner you realize the importance of displays for your business growth. Unlike an online business that shoppers visit with the intention to shop for a particular product or only a couple of types of items, brick and mortar businesses need to make sure that all their wares are prominently displayed to their consumers in order to make a sale. Items that are not on display or not in prominent display are not sold and get added to the unsold inventory at the end of the day. Though this is a bad thing to happen to any business, this is a crippling loss for a store that deals with perishable items like fruits and vegetables. Such a store will go out of business very soon if regular unsold inventory is a regular occurrence.

Consequently, the idea is to make sure that each item is on proper display so interested consumers can buy them and the business stays profitable. Most of the stores use regular rows of racks that stack the products in one line after another, with each line or rack space catering a particular type of items. However, single lines of racks are not very effective to display items in corners. For such cases, corner racks are an ideal way to display the merchandise and increase your sales.

Let’s understand the usage and utility of a corner rack from the point of view of increased sales potential.

Advertise and Sell More: If you are planning to advertise a certain item or trying to increase the sales of a certain product, experts suggest putting them in smaller corner racks. These small racks stand by themselves in a corner and have only a few products on display. The fact that they stand by themselves in their space and do not get lost in the lines of racks means that customers notice the things on them more often, even though they may miss the same products if they are kept on the regular racks. Also, since these items are in their corner rack, separate from the rest means that customers will give them a premium rating by their mere placement and will have a tendency to buy them more consistently.

Smaller and More Personalized Displays: These corner racks are ideal to display items that are smaller in size or have a premium value attached to them. Since the corner racks are smaller, they can be easily made to show off items in a very appealing manner. This means that customers will see these items more often and will also buy them more frequently.

Make Use of the Unprofitable Corners: Each store has corners against which no standard racks can be fitted. The corner racks fit in quite well in such places. As a store owner, you can maximize the sales potential of your square footage and use the corner racks to make more sales.
